Overview

What is DataFog?

DataFog is an open-source DevSecOps platform that lets you scan and redact Personally Identifiable Information (PII) out of your Generative AI applications.

Installation

DataFog can be installed via pip:

pip install datafog

Text PII Annotation

To annotate PII in a given text, lets start with a set of clinical notes:

!git clone https://gist.github.com/b43b72693226422bac5f083c941ecfdb.git
# Define the directory path
folder_path = 'clinical_notes/'

# List all files in the directory
file_list = os.listdir(folder_path)
text_files = sorted([file for file in file_list if file.endswith('.txt')])

with open(os.path.join(folder_path, text_files[0]), 'r') as file:
    clinical_note = file.read()

display(Markdown(clinical_note))

which looks like this:

we can then set up our pipeline to accept these files

async def run_text_pipeline_demo():
  results = await datafog.run_text_pipeline(texts)
  print("Text Pipeline Results:", results)
  return results


texts = [clinical_note]
loop = asyncio.get_event_loop()
results = loop.run_until_complete(run_text_pipeline_demo())

Note: The DataFog library uses asynchronous programming, so make sure to use the async/await syntax when calling the appropriate methods.

OCR PII Annotation

Let's use a image (which could easily be a converted or scanned PDF)

Executive Email

datafog = DataFog(operations='extract_text')
url_list = ['https://pbs.twimg.com/media/GM3-wpeWkAAP-cX.jpg']

async def run_ocr_pipeline_demo():
  results = await datafog.run_ocr_pipeline(url_list)
  print("OCR Pipeline Results:", results)

loop = asyncio.get_event_loop()
loop.run_until_complete(run_ocr_pipeline_demo())

You'll notice that we use async functions liberally throughout the SDK - given the nature of the functions we're providing and the extension of DataFog into API/other formats, this allows the functions to be more easily adapted for those uses.
